Etymology 2[edit]
From Yelena Produnova (Елена Серге́евна Продунова) who in 1999 was the first to successfully perform this maneuver in competition.
Noun[edit]
Produnova (plural Produnovas)
- (gymnastics) a vault on the vaulting horse or vaulting table that starts with a front handspring off the gymnastics horse leading to two-and-a-half somersaults in the air, and then landing on their feet. (a three-point landing with the butt and feet is considered a fall)
Synonyms[edit]
(Gymnastics vault):
- vault of death (so called due to the dangerousness of the vault, and likelihood of ending up landing on one's neck)
- Produnova vault
